Incognito is the sixth album by Spyro Gyra, released in 1982. At Billboard it reached No. 46 on the Top 200 Albums chart, and No. 2 on that magazine's Jazz Albums chart.

Personnel
Spyro Gyra
- Jay Beckenstein â saxophones, whistle (2), percussion (2)
- Tom Schuman â Yamaha GS-1 (1), synthesizers (1, 2, 5, 6), electric piano (3, 5, 6, 8), acoustic piano (6)
- Jeremy Wall â electric piano (7)
- Chet Catallo â guitar textures (3), guitars (4, 8)
- John Tropea â guitar textures (3), slide guitar (4), guitars (5, 7)
- Gerardo Velez â percussion (1, 2, 4, 8)
- Dave Samuels â marimba (2, 6, 7), vibraphone (3, 7, 8)
Additional musicians
- Jorge Dalto â acoustic piano (2)
- Rob Mounsey â synthesizers (2, 5âÂÂ7), vocoder (3, 6, 7)
- Richard Tee â acoustic piano (4, 8), organ (4)
- Hiram Bullock â guitar solo (1), guitars (6)
- Steve Love â guitars (1, 3âÂÂ8), acoustic guitar (2), electric guitar (2)
- Will Lee â bass (1)
- Marcus Miller â bass (2âÂÂ8)
- Steve Gadd â drums
- Manolo Badrena â congas (1), percussion (2, 5âÂÂ7)
- Crusher Bennett â congas (5, 7)
- Toots Thielemans â harmonica (4)
- Tom Scott â Lyricon (5)
